3.2 Liquidated Damages. OWNER and CONTRACTOR recognize that time is of the
essence of this Agreement and that OWNER will suffer financial loss if the work is not
completed within the times specified in Paragraph 3 . 1 above, plus any extensions thereof
allowed in accordance with Article 12 of the General Conditions. They also recognize the
delays, expense and difficulties involved in proving in a legal proceeding the actual loss
suffered by OWNER if the work is not completed on time . Accordingly, instead of
requiring any such proof, OWNER and CONTRACTOR agree that as liquidated damages
for delay (but not as a penalty) CONTRACTOR shall pay OWNER four-hundred and fifty
dollars ($450. 00) for each day that expires after the time specified in Paragraph 3. 1 for
Substantial Completion , if CONTRACTOR shall neglect, refuse or fail to complete the
remaining work within the Contract Time or any proper extension thereof granted by
OWNER, CONTRACTOR shall pay OWNER four-hundred and fifty dollars ($450.00) for
each day that expires after the time specified in Paragraph 3. 1 for completion and
readiness for final payment.

5. 1 Progress Payments. The OWNER shall make progress payments to the CONTRACTOR
on the basis of the approved partial payment request as recommended by ENGINEER in
accordance with the provisions of the Local Government Prompt Payment Act, Florida
Statutes section 218.70 et. seq . The OWNER shall retain ten percent ( 10%) of the
payment amounts due to the CONTRACTOR until fifty percent (50%) completion of the
work. After fifty percent (50%) completion of the work is attained as certified to OWNER by
ENGINEER in writing , OWNER shall retain five percent (5%) of the payment amount due
to CONTRACTOR until final completion and acceptance of all work to be performed by
CONTRACTOR under the Contract Documents . Pursuant to Florida Statutes section
218.735(8) (b), fifty percent (50%) completion means the point at which the County as
OWNER has expended fifty percent (50%) of the total cost of the construction services
work purchased under the Contract Documents , together with all costs associated with
existing change orders and other additions or modifications to the construction services
work provided under the Contract Documents.
5.2 Pay Requests. Each request for a progress payment shall be submitted on the application
for payment form supplied by OWNER and the application for payment shall contain the
CONTRACTOR's certification . All progress payments will be on the basis of progress of
the work measured by the schedule of values established , or in the case of unit price work
based on the number of units completed . After fifty percent (50%) completion , and
pursuant to Florida Statutes section 218.735(8)(d) , the CONTRACTOR may submit a pay
request to the County as OWNER for up to one half ( 1 /2) of the retainage held by the
County as OWNER , and the County as OWNER shall promptly make payment to the
CONTRACTOR unless such amounts are the subject of a good faith dispute; the subject
of a claim pursuant to Florida Statutes section 255.05(2005) ; or otherwise the subject of a
claim or demand by the County as OWNER or the CONTRACTOR. The CONTRACTOR
acknowledges that where such retainage is attributable to the labor, services, or materials
supplied by one or more subcontractors or suppliers, the Contractor shall timely remit
payment of such retainage to those subcontractors and suppliers. Pursuant to Florida
Statutes section 218.735(8)(c)(2005) , CONTRACTOR further acknowledges and agrees
that: 1 ) the County as OWNER shall receive immediate written notice of all decisions
made by CONTRACTOR to withhold retainage on any subcontractor at greater than five
percent (5%) after fifty percent (50%) completion ; and 2) CONTRACTOR will not seek
release from the County as OWNER of the withheld retainage until the final pay request.
